Band 6 Physiotherapist – Community in Bristol UK – £26 Hourly – Ongoing

Are you ready to embark on a fantastic career journey as a Band 6 Physiotherapist within the community in the vibrant city of Bristol UK? We are offering a rewarding full-time position with an hourly rate of £26. This ongoing opportunity is perfect for a driven individual who excels in providing exceptional health care.

Perks and benefits:

  • Locum flexibility: Enjoy the freedom that comes with locum work, where you can control your schedule and maintain that crucial work-life balance.
  • Competitive earnings: Our competitive hourly rate allows you to earn as you work, giving you more control over your income.
  • Varied experience: Gain enriching experience in diverse environments and broaden your professional skills.
  • Networking opportunities: Meet and work with a wide array of professionals in the healthcare field, enhancing your career growth significantly.

What you will do:

  • Work autonomously in patients’ homes, conducting assessments and providing tailored rehabilitation plans for individuals who have been referred for physiotherapy intervention.
  • Deliver high-quality care and continually assess the effectiveness of interventions.
  • Work collaboratively with a diverse team of healthcare professionals to ensure comprehensive patient care and service delivery.
  • Document patient progress meticulously and report any changes in condition to the appropriate healthcare team members.

To excel in this role, you must be HCPC registered and possess a full driving licence, as this role requires travel between patients’ homes.
